Elasticsearch powers search functionality at thousands of companies in 2026, and engineers with search expertise earn $150K-$210K at senior levels. The Elastic Stack (Elasticsearch, Kibana, Logstash, Beats) also dominates log analytics and observability, creating two distinct career paths: search engineering and observability platform engineering. OpenSearch, the AWS fork, has split the market somewhat but the underlying skills are identical.
Employers hiring Elasticsearch specialists look for experience with mapping design, query optimization, relevance tuning, and cluster sizing. The most valuable skills include understanding BM25 and vector search for hybrid retrieval, index lifecycle management for log data, and cross-cluster replication for global deployments. With the rise of AI, Elasticsearch's vector search capabilities have become increasingly important for retrieval-augmented generation (RAG) systems, creating a new growth area at the intersection of search engineering and AI infrastructure.
